Adragna Architecture Salary

As of July 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Adragna Architecture in the United States is $89,827.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$43. Salaries at Adragna Architecture typically range from $78,953 to $101,624 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Adragna Architecture
Solution based architecture driven by creative design and problem solving. Based in Denver, Ryan and Casey Adragna bring a high level of service to many project types.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Denver?

Understanding the cost of living near Denver is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Adragna Architecture.
Denver's Cost of Living Index is approximately 112.1 (12.1% more expensive than US average; 6.5% more than CO average). Housing costs are the primary driver above US average, high demand, vibrant city. Light Rail/Bus (RTD).
